    MediaPortal is an open-source media player and digital video recorder software project, often considered an alternative to Windows Media Center. [1] [2] It provides a 10-foot user interface for performing typical PVR/TiVo functionality, including playing, pausing, and recording live TV; playing DVDs, videos, and music; viewing pictures; and other functions.
